Output 048858ac1993afafbe33887949b49e4ed2f3ffe5912efc2d66a876f2a6b987da:99

value
389622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560dd6a2dfd473f56ff296494d31c7219a25ef1e OP_EQUAL
address
39Y2cYwyFHfGDV1WxMuPciXzntp5drSmdt
transaction
048858ac1993afafbe33887949b49e4ed2f3ffe5912efc2d66a876f2a6b987da
spent
true